This afternoon, June 26, before the math exam for the high school graduation exam, at the exam site of Trung Vuong Secondary School (Hoan Kiem District, Hanoi ), the image of teachers from Hong Ha High School carefully calling each student right in front of the school gate, continuously calling those who had not arrived, left many emotions.
This year, 42 students from Hong Ha High School took the high school graduation exam. To ensure that no student was late, the teachers arrived early and marked their students on the list as they arrived and passed through the exam gate.
Mr. Dat and Ms. Hien carefully checked each student on the list to see if they had arrived at the exam location.

Ms. Nguyen Thu Hien, an economics and law teacher at the school, shared: “Like every year, the homeroom teachers are always present at the exam site about 30 minutes in advance to take attendance of students, in case they have any problems on the road. At the same time, the presence of the teachers is also a way to help students feel more confident before the exam."
According to the regulations, candidates who are more than 15 minutes late will not be allowed to take the graduation exam. Therefore, if the students have not appeared yet, the teachers will call and contact the parents to urge them to arrive on time because in 12 years of studying, this is the time when they are not allowed to be late.
According to Ms. Hien, this year is the first time the high school graduation exam is organized according to the new generaleducation program, focusing on assessing abilities instead of just testing memorized knowledge. This makes students and teachers both nervous and worried.

“With the motto "learning with love", we always put companionship first. We do not put pressure on scores, but hope that children will take the exam with calmness, confidence and the best mindset,” Ms. Hien added.
Present with Ms. Hien, Mr. Nguyen Trong Dat, a teacher at Hong Ha High School, carefully called out the names of each student on the list.
“Ms. Hien and I came to take attendance of our students taking the exam at Trung Vuong Secondary School. We have maintained this for the past 15 years. Once, when I saw a student absent, I was very worried and immediately contacted the family. Luckily, the student arrived on time. I felt really relieved at that moment,” said Mr. Dat.

Mr. Dat also shared: "Teachers are not only teachers in class but also companions with students during important moments in life. Seeing our students arrive in full, on time, with confident eyes and a steady mentality before exams makes teachers like us feel at ease."
According to Mr. Dat, although this is the first year of taking exams under the new general education program with many big changes, in the teaching process, teachers have felt the efforts of students over the past 3 years of study. Therefore, teachers believe that if students do the test with their true ability and mindset, the results will be worthy of the effort they put in.
Feeling the special attention of teachers, some candidates who are students of Hong Ha High School shared that they were more motivated and felt more comfortable knowing that there were always teachers who cared and followed them.
This afternoon, candidates will take the math test in 90 minutes. Compared to previous years, the math test (and multiple-choice tests) for candidates taking the 2018 General Education Program will be more diverse in format. In addition to the multiple-choice test format, there will also be true/false and short-answer formats. The test will be arranged from easy to difficult.
